Definitions:

Atrioventricular Node

A part of the heart's electrical system situated between the atria and ventricles that regulates the timing of heart muscle contractions.

Action Potential

Brief reversal of the charge difference across a neuron membrane.

Veins

Blood vessels that carry blood toward the heart, typically carrying deoxygenated blood from the tissues back to the heart except in the case of pulmonary veins.

Hemostasis

The physiological process by which bleeding ceases, involving blood vessel constriction and clot formation.
